Quick note for support before this merges: the new throttle in Docwright means that when a customer's repo has a huge docs tree, the linter now queues files instead of scanning them all at once. So if someone reports "lint results are slow to appear," that's probably this, not an outage. Point them at the queue-depth metric first. Also, the timeouts got stricter, so giant single files will now error cleanly with a code you can look up. The relevant knobs are these.

constants for tageg-kagag:
QUOTAS = {
    "kelax": 495,
    "istath": 366,
    "tammir": 108,
    "novdor": 730,
    "casax": 816,
    "quenael": 874,
    "pelius": 403,
}

The Orvelle Playhouse seat-map renderer draws the auditorium from a static layout file and overlays live availability from the booking service. It runs client-side except for the availability fetch, which is proxied through our backend. Configuration sits in the proxy's .env file. The booking service credential should be placed on the next line.

sealed setting: ARCHIVE_KEY3=8d0

Runbook — Crashfern mobile pipeline. If crash reports stop flowing after a release, first confirm the symbol upload completed, then restart the ingest worker on the Thistledown cluster. Hold the release train until report volume recovers to baseline. The build token for the last known-good ingest worker follows below.

session token of tajef-bageg = htk21_5d90d574934f3ccae6437

# Artifact Signing — Plierview

Plierview, our diff viewer for large files, produces platform bundles on every tagged build. Because the chunked-rendering engine links native code, unsigned bundles will not load on hardened hosts. The signing step runs last in the pipeline, after the memory-mapping tests pass. Maintainers verifying a bundle by hand should check its signature against the release key below.

signing key of bagap-yawep = bky13_TbfT6ZMUoGJo2

CI note: the Paylark export job started failing after Tuesday's schema change moved the deductions column into a nested block. The fixture files in payroll-export-tests still use the flat layout, so the diff check trips on every run. Regenerate fixtures with the v4 flag before retrying. If it still fails, compare against the last green run using the token below.

trace token, kahop-yawig: htk9_dd7ffd8bb